Sambhav drive for expectant mothers, kids

Lucknow: Fortifying its effort to fight malnutrition in children and expectant mothers, the state women and child development department rolled out the Sambhav campaign with a training workshop for stakeholders here on Monday. The campaign will get in action at 1.89 lakh anganwadi centres for three months from July.
Minister Baby Rani Maurya said: “The aim is not just to identify and manage high risk pregnancies, address low birth weight babies and severely malnourished children. It also commits itself to encouraging people and communities that work to mitigate the social problem.”
Secretary Anamika Singh said: “Started as an innovation in 2021, the campaign works towards achieving inter-departmental coordination to ensure that the benefits of government schemes of all allied departments are also being extended to the beneficiary families .”
